About the product

Ceramic Soap is a highly hydrophobic, concentrated shampoo with a high content of SiO₂. Ideal for the care of cars protected with ceramic coatings, waxes, PPF and vinyl wraps, on which it significantly enhances the gloss, gives a very strong hydrophobic effect and increases surface slickness. It will also work great as a standalone protective product.

Ceramic Soap can be used as a traditional car shampoo, providing excellent slickness and a gentle foam, or applied with a foam lance. The product can be used on all external surfaces of the car. A pleasant bubblegum fragrance makes the product more enjoyable to use.

Ceramic Soap is an ideal finishing step for a thorough detailing wash, whether in a professional studio or an enthusiast’s garage.

Does Ceramic Soap affect the slickness and gloss of the paint?

Yes, the product significantly increases surface slickness, which makes it harder for dirt to settle. Furthermore, the high SiO2 content ensures the paintwork gains a glassy shine and a refreshed appearance.

On which exterior surfaces can Ceramic Soap be used?

The shampoo can be safely used on all exterior components of the car, including the paintwork, glass, plastics, and wheels. Working with the product is made even more enjoyable by its bubblegum scent.

Can Ceramic Soap be applied using a foam lance?

Yes, Ceramic Soap offers its full range of capabilities when applied via a foam lance as well. This method allows for a quick and uniform application of the protective ingredients across the entire bodywork.

Is Ceramic Soap safe for PPF and vinyl wraps?

Yes, the shampoo is completely safe and highly recommended for the maintenance of cars protected with PPF (Paint Protection Film) or vinyl wraps. Regular washing with Ceramic Soap significantly enhances the visual appeal of the film and makes it much easier to keep clean.

Can Ceramic Soap be used as standalone paint protection?

Yes, the product works perfectly as a standalone form of protection, giving the paintwork a high gloss and self-cleaning properties. It is an excellent solution for those looking for a quick way to protect their car without the need for additional products.

What is the difference between Ceramic Soap and a traditional car shampoo?

Ceramic Soap contains a high concentration of silica (SiO2), which leaves a protective layer during the wash itself. Unlike ordinary shampoos, this product significantly boosts the surface's hydrophobicity and slickness.
